Cub Cadet LT1045 Coolant Capacity

Quick answer:

The Cub Cadet LT1045 coolant capacity is listed as 0.63 gal (2.4 L). It also lists coolant type ethylene glycol-based coolant.

Coolant capacity0.63 gal (2.4 L)
Coolant typeethylene glycol-based coolant
